I replaced those two sliding covers with the help of a friend. It is not for the faint of heart, but certainly doable. My X5 does have 4-zone climate control as well as DVD for the rear entertainment, which made the process even more difficult.
Note that the entire center console needs to come out. I thought about a workaround but couldn't find any. We followed the steps at newtis.info to remove the center console. Good luck!
